Health Care Personnel's Perspectives on Quality of Palliative Care During the COVID-19 Pandemic - A Cross-Sectional Study.

Marie Dahlen GranrudVigdis Abrahamsen GrøndahlAnn Karin HelgesenCarina BååthCecilia OlssonMaria TillforsChristina Melin-JohanssonJane ÖsterlindMaria LarssonReidun HovTuva Sandsdalen
Published in: Journal of multidisciplinary healthcare (2023)
Study results indicate that HCP from nursing homes, medical care units, and intensive care units perceived that quality of palliative care provided was not in line with what they perceived to be important for the patient. This indicate that it was challenging to provide high-quality palliative care during the COVID-19 pandemic.
